Software Alternatives, Accelerators & Startups

OSS Document Scanner VS Socket for Python

Compare OSS Document Scanner VS Socket for Python and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

OSS Document Scanner logo OSS Document Scanner

Open-source mobile solution for document management; scan, recognize text, and share as PDF with ease.

Socket for Python logo Socket for Python

Keep your Python code secure and compliant with Socket
Not present
  • Socket for Python Landing page
    Landing page //
    2023-09-02

OSS Document Scanner features and specs

  • Open Source
    OSS Document Scanner is open source, allowing developers to inspect, modify, and enhance the code to suit their needs.
  • Community Support
    Being hosted on GitHub, the project benefits from community contributions, bug reports, and feature requests that can improve the software over time.
  • Customizability
    As an open-source project, developers can customize the software to add features tailored to specific use cases or workflows.
  • Cost-effective
    Being free to use and modify, it eliminates licensing fees associated with proprietary document scanning solutions.

Possible disadvantages of OSS Document Scanner

  • Limited Documentation
    OSS Document Scanner may have less comprehensive documentation compared to commercial alternatives, potentially increasing the learning curve for new users.
  • Potentially Reduced Support
    Community-driven support may not be as immediate or comprehensive as a paid support service offered by commercial software providers.
  • Maintenance and Updates
    As an open-source project, future updates and maintenance rely on community and developer interest, which can vary over time.
  • Compatibility Issues
    Being a niche tool, there might be compatibility issues with certain devices or operating systems that are not as thoroughly tested as those for commercial products.

Socket for Python features and specs

  • Security Focus
    Socket provides a primary emphasis on security, offering tools and features that help developers secure their Python applications and dependencies against various vulnerabilities.
  • Dependency Analysis
    The platform offers thorough analysis of dependencies, allowing developers to understand the security posture of third-party packages in their projects and manage them accordingly.
  • Ease of Integration
    Socket is designed to integrate seamlessly into existing Python development workflows, minimizing disruptions while enhancing security.
  • Real-time Monitoring
    Socket allows for real-time monitoring of package security, giving developers immediate alerts about newly discovered vulnerabilities or issues in their dependencies.

Possible disadvantages of Socket for Python

  • Learning Curve
    Developers new to security-focused tools might face a learning curve in understanding how to fully leverage Socket's features and capabilities.
  • Platform Limitations
    As with any tool, Socket may have limitations in compatibility with certain Python environments or frameworks, which could pose challenges for some projects.
  • Dependency on Tool
    Relying heavily on Socket for security may lead to a dependency on the platform, which could be a concern if there are outages or changes in support.
  • Possible Performance Overheads
    The security checks and real-time monitoring features, while beneficial, might introduce some performance overheads in the development process.

Category Popularity

0-100% (relative to OSS Document Scanner and Socket for Python)
OCR
100 100%
0% 0
Software Development
0 0%
100% 100
Tool
100 100%
0% 0
Developer Tools
0 0%
100% 100

User comments

Share your experience with using OSS Document Scanner and Socket for Python.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ing OSS Document Scanner and Socket for Python, you can also consider the following products

GImageReader - gImageReader is a simple Gtk/Qt front-end to the Tesseract OCR Engine.

Kite - Kite helps you write code faster by bringing the web's programming knowledge into your editor.

OpenScan - FOSS Document Scanner

Sourcery - Sourcery reviews your code everywhere you work and automatically suggests improvements

Tesseract - Tesseract is an optical character recognition engine for various operating systems

NormCap - NormCap is one of the smart programs that allows optical character recognition, enabling you to mark anything on the desktop to retrieve the text part of it and get it copied to the Windows clipboard.